A BILL TO BE ENTITLED

AN ACT to APPROPRIATE FUNDS TO THE Department of Health and Human Services FOR THE ADOLESCENT PREGNANCY PREVENTION CAMPAIGN OF NORTH CAROLINA.

The General Assembly of North Carolina enacts:

SECTION 1.  There is appropriated from the General Fund to the Department of Health and Human Services, Division of Public Health, the sum of two hundred fifty thousand dollars ($250,000) for the 2009‑2010 fiscal year and the sum of two hundred fifty thousand dollars ($250,000) for the 2010‑2011 fiscal year.  These funds shall be allocated as a grant‑in‑aid to the Adolescent Pregnancy Prevention Campaign of North Carolina.

SECTION 2.  The Adolescent Pregnancy Prevention Campaign of North Carolina ("Campaign") shall use funds allocated in Section 1 of this act to match grants from private sources so that the Campaign may continue to work with and provide technical support to groups, communities, professionals, and individuals in organizing and implementing programs to prevent adolescent pregnancies.

SECTION 3.  This act becomes effective July 1, 2009.
